FRANKFORT, Kentucky, Feb. 22 -- The Kentucky Department of Agriculture issued the following news release on Feb. 21, 2024:
On the first Saturday in May, all eyes around the world will be on Kentucky. This year marks the 150th running of the Kentucky Derby - the longest continually held sporting event in the country.
